Output 773638ba75d4aec8c4ab96d4dc7a81e58d0842ebe731a31f91b07cd02e2301fd:0

value
6964999936126
script pubkey
OP_0 OP_PUSHBYTES_20 81f0e9bc1e304e439ea8112259ec3252d47ea120
address
tb1qs8cwn0q7xp8y884gzy39nmpj2t28agfqahleqg
transaction
773638ba75d4aec8c4ab96d4dc7a81e58d0842ebe731a31f91b07cd02e2301fd
confirmations
171379
spent
true